腾讯云怎么搭建了ftp服务端
时间 : 2024-02-19 19:06:03声明: : 文章内容来自网络,不保证准确性,请自行甄别信息有效性

最佳答案

在腾讯云上搭建FTP服务端可以方便地进行文件的上传、下载和管理。本文将介绍如何使用腾讯云轻量级应用服务器快速搭建FTP服务端。

步骤一:创建轻量级应用服务器实例

登录腾讯云官网,在控制台中选择轻量级应用服务器,并点击创建按钮。根据需求选择实例的配置,例如选择地域、操作系统、机型、网络等。同时设置登录密码或者使用密钥方式进行登录。

步骤二:连接到服务器

创建实例完成后,点击连接,可以获取到服务器的公网IP,通过SSH工具(如Xshell、PuTTY等)连接到服务器。

步骤三:安装FTP服务

连接到服务器后,首先执行`sudo apt update`命令,更新软件源。接着执行`sudo apt install vsftpd -y`命令,安装vsftpd软件包。

步骤四:配置FTP服务

安装完成后,进入`/etc/vsftpd.conf`文件进行配置。可以使用`sudo vi /etc/vsftpd.conf`命令编辑该文件。

在配置文件中,可以根据需要进行相关配置。例如,可以设置`anonymous_enable=NO`禁止匿名访问,设置`write_enable=YES`允许写入权限等。配置完成后,使用`:wq`命令保存并退出。

步骤五:重启FTP服务

配置完成后,执行`sudo systemctl restart vsftpd`命令重启FTP服务。

步骤六:设置防火墙规则

为了能够通过FTP访问服务器,需要设置相应的防火墙规则。在腾讯云控制台中选择对应实例的安全组,添加FTP的入站规则,允许TCP端口21和20访问。

步骤七:测试FTP连接

完成上述步骤后,使用FTP客户端工具(如FileZilla等)连接到服务器。输入服务器的地址、用户名和密码,选择FTP传输模式,点击连接。

如果一切配置正确,即可成功连接到FTP服务器,并进行文件的上传、下载和管理。

总结

通过腾讯云轻量级应用服务器搭建FTP服务端非常简单。只需要创建实例、安装配置FTP软件、设置防火墙规则和测试连接等几个步骤,就可以快速搭建一个可靠稳定的FTP服务端。希望本文对您有所帮助!

其他答案

腾讯云是一家知名的云计算服务提供商,为用户提供了丰富的云服务。其中,搭建FTP服务端是其中一项常见的需求。下面将介绍如何在腾讯云上搭建FTP服务端。

登录到腾讯云的控制台。在控制台中,选择“云产品”->“云服务器”->“实例管理”->“新建实例”选项。在新建实例页面中,按照自己的需求选择实例的配置,例如地域、操作系统、规格等。在操作系统选择上,可以选择适合的Linux操作系统,如CentOS、Ubuntu等。

然后,等待实例创建完成后,选择已创建的实例,点击“登录”按钮,通过SSH协议进行远程登录到服务器操作系统。在服务器中安装FTP服务软件,常用的有ProFTPD、vsftpd等。这里以vsftpd为例,可以通过以下命令进行安装:sudo apt-get install vsftpd(如果使用CentOS系统,则使用命令sudo yum install -y vsftpd进行安装)。

安装完成后,使用编辑器打开vsftpd的配置文件,路径通常为/etc/vsftpd.conf,并进行相关配置。其中,常见的配置项包括:确定服务监听的端口号、设定本地用户和密码、指定FTP的根目录、限制FTP用户的访问权限等。

配置完成后,重启FTP服务,使配置生效。可以使用以下命令重启vsftpd服务:sudo systemctl restart vsftpd(如果使用CentOS系统,则使用命令sudo service vsftpd restart进行重启)。

接下来,需要设置防火墙规则,允许FTP的数据传输端口通过。例如,使用iptables命令:sudo iptables -A INPUT -p tcp --dport 20 -j ACCEPT(如果使用CentOS系统,则使用iptables-save命令保存规则)。这样,客户端可以通过FTP协议与服务器进行数据传输。

通过FTP客户端软件,如FileZilla、WinSCP等,输入服务器的IP地址、端口号、账号和密码进行连接。成功连接后,就可以在本地进行文件的上传、下载和管理操作了。

总结起来,搭建FTP服务端在腾讯云上并不复杂,只需按照以上步骤进行配置和安装即可。通过FTP服务,可以方便地实现文件的传输和管理,提升工作效率和便捷性。